Romelu Lukaku transfer news: The Manchester United striker has been speculated with a move away from the club.

Manchester United have been impressive under Ole Gunnar Solskjaer so far. The side is on a seven-game unbeaten run across all competitions, with six-match winning streak in the Premier League.

A goal each from Paul Pogba and Marcus Rashford secured a 2-1 win over Brighton last weekend. The club is now only three points behind the fourth-placed Chelsea and level on points with Arsenal, who are fifth.

Rashford has been one of the most impressive of all the United players under Solskjaer, as the forward bagged five goals in the last six league games. Justifiably, he remains the first-choice option in the side, ahead of Romelu Lukaku.

Lukaku has not been entirely shunned away from the side, however, and has made substitute appearances since coming back into the side from compassionate leave. He also scored in FA Cup tie against Reading, where he started as Solskjaer rested the English youngster.

However, there have been increasing reports of Lukaku’s departure from Manchester United. But according to Express, the striker has replied to the reports.

Romelu Lukaku transfer news:

Lukaku has been strongly linked with a move away from Old Trafford after his place in the starting XI was taken by Marcus Rashford under Solskjaer.

Romelu Lukaku has, however, scored three goals under Solskjaer despite having started only one game in his charge so far.


However, the striker posted a cryptic message on Instagram, which read, “When the hate don’t work they start telling lies…”

Lukaku has faced inconsistency in form throughout this season. The Belgian star has scored 9 goals across all the competitions this season so far, but endured an eight-game goalless patch earlier this season.

With Lukaku, Alexis Sanchez has also been spending time on the bench. However, the Chilean attacker was out injured and was seemingly hurried into starting the game against Reading in the FA Cup tie earlier this month.

However, Solskjaer confirmed in the post-match conference after victory against Brighton that Alexis Sanchez could be back in action against his former side Arsenal as the side aims to secure a spot in the fifth round of the FA Cup.
